@charset "utf-8";

@media screen and (min-width:481px) and (max-width:768px) {
html {font-size: 13px;}

/*= inner 100% =============================*/
.inner {width: 98%;
margin: 0 auto 0;
padding: 0;}

.inner:after{content: "";
display: block;
clear: both}

/*  netprint-indexmenu  ------------------------------------------------*/
#netprint-indexmenu section h1 {display:none;}

/*  contents sidemenu ------------------------------------------------*/
#contents .col-left {float: none;
padding:0.55%;
width: 100%;}

#contents .col-right {float: none;
width: 100%;}

/*==========================================
 Footer
===========================================*/
footer .inner nav {margin: 8px 8px 8px;}
footer .inner nav ul{margin:0; padding:0; list-style: none;}
footer .inner nav ul li {margin:0; padding: 0;}
footer .inner nav ul li a{display: block;
margin:4px;
padding: 8px 18px;
color: #ffffff;
border:1px solid #ffffff;
text-decoration: none;}
footer .inner nav ul li a:hover,
footer .inner nav ul li a:active {background-color:#fcfff4; color:#333333; text-decoration: none;}



}
